The Belgian Grand Prix at Spa-Francorchamps takes place this Sunday, July 19, as the final race before Formula 1's summer break. Kimi Antonelli's championship lead over teammate George Russell has decreased to 25 points, following challenges in recent races. In the title race, Lewis Hamilton is within striking distance, just seven points behind Russell. This race weekend, known for its unpredictable weather, brings attention to multiple drivers including four-time champion Max Verstappen, whose recent performance has led to speculation about his future with Red Bull. Coverage will start at 12:30 PM local time, with the race set for 2 PM.
